In New Zealand.

Ihe following are the headquarters' officers of the Wellington Battalion:— Lieut.-Colonel: Lieut.-l'olonel William Georgo Malone, 11th Regiment (Taranaki llitles). Major: Major Herbert Hart, 17th (Ruahine) Regiment. Adjutant: Gaptain Michael O'Donnell, New Zealand Staff Corps. Assistant Adjutant: Gaptain John Murray Rose, New Zealand Staff Corps. Regimental Transport Officer: Lieut. Eric Morgan, Uth (Ilawke's Bay) Regiment. Quartermaster: Honorary Captain William James Shepherd, 11th Regiment (Taranaki Hi lies).

Attached.—Medical Officers: Captain Georgo Home, New Zealand Medical Corps. Lieut. Ernest John Herbert Webb, New Zealand Medical Corps. Tho officers of the lltli (Taranaki Rifles) Company are:—Major: Major John Wallace Brunt. Captain: Captain Edward Percy Cox. Subalterns: Lieut. Godfrey Clapham Wells. Lieut. William l'rancis Xarbey. Second Lieutenant Alexander Bastin McColl. Second Lieutenant Murray Urrjuhart.
